England's Lord of Fraud: Wolf of the West End
In 2014 convicted fraudster and infamous British socialite "Lord" Edward Davenport was released early from prison in controversial circumstances. With exclusive...
In 2014 convicted fraudster and infamous British socialite "Lord" Edward Davenport was released early from prison in controversial circumstances. With exclusive access to Eddie and his world, VICE charts Eddie's meteoric rise to fame in 80s as the brains behind the infamous elite underage Gatecrasher Balls, to him conning the Sierra Leone government out of their London embassy, only to hold exclusive sex parties in it, to his dramatic fall as a result of a multimillion pound fraud, of which he was cited as the "puppet master".
A film that navigates the highs and lows of Eddie calls "the fast lane", this is both an intimate portrait of a notorious enigma of a man, and the frenzy that lies in his wake, "Wolf Of The West End" charters unprecedented territory in its depiction of perversion in the upper echelons of British society

London (United Kingdom) Vacation Travel Video Guide
✱ 2180 Hotels in London - Lowest Price Guarantee ► http://goo.gl/tuEtwR
Travel video about destination London in England.
London is an exciting and pulsating m...
✱ 2180 Hotels in London - Lowest Price Guarantee ► http://goo.gl/tuEtwR
Travel video about destination London in England.
London is an exciting and pulsating metropolis of the new millennium, a melting pot of both people and culture and a fascinating city of diverse contrasts.
The City Of London contains the Tower, an historic landmark with a remarkable history. A mighty medieval fortress with 13 towers that throughout its 900 years, has served many functions and from the Middle Ages, it was a heavily fortified prison.
After the medieval St. Paul's Cathedral was destroyed by a devastating fire in 1666, Christopher Wren was ordered to re-build it with a dome. During the 36 years of its construction, its design was frequently altered until finally a wonderful masterpiece of church architecture was created.
The Monument is the city's tallest freestanding stone column and a reminder of the Great Fire of London that destroyed 80 percent of the city. In four days, more than 13,000 buildings were destroyed and the Monument was built on the site of the bakery in which the fire began.
Since the reign of Queen Victoria, Buckingham Palace has served as London's royal residence. A garden of mulberry trees once grew on the site of today's palace and the Duke of Buckingham subsequently added a simple brick built residence. Around 60 years later, George II purchased the site for his wife and George IV eventually began to design an extensive palace complex.
The highlight of any holiday in London must be the largest Ferris wheel in the world, the London Eye. Situated on the banks of the Thames, it rises high into the sky, opposite the Houses of Parliament and Big Ben.
The former centre of the largest empire in the world, London is still a city of superlatives that attracts millions of visitors each year. Exciting both day and night, London is a modern city with age old traditions and a long and colorful history.

Top 10 Attractions London - UK Travel Guide
Take a tour of Top 10 Travel Attractions of London, England - part of the World's Greatest Attractions series by GeoBeats.
Hey, it is your host, Naomi. I would...
Take a tour of Top 10 Travel Attractions of London, England - part of the World's Greatest Attractions series by GeoBeats.
Hey, it is your host, Naomi. I would like to show you the top 10 attractions of London.
#10: St. Paul's Cathedral - the seat of the bishop of London today. Five churches have been built here, with the first one in the 7th century.
#9: Trafalgar Square - a famous square in central London. At the center is Nelson Square, surrounded by fountains.
#8: The double decker bus - Take a ride in this London icon, a great way to tour the city.
#7: The Thames River cruise - Experience the city by water. Many of London's attractions are visible from the cruise.
#6: Covent Garden - Literally a vegetable garden in the middle ages, today it is a hub of restaurants, pubs and shops.
#5: Tower of London - Built over 900 years ago, it is a historic landmark. Take a guided tour and learn about its many secrets.
#4: London Bridge - one of the world's most famous bridges. Constructed in 1894, it is an engineering marvel.
#3: Houses of Parliament - Also known as Westminster Palace, it is the seat of London's House of Lords and House of Commons.
#2: Buckingham Palace - This is the residence of the British monarch. The changing of the guard is not to be missed.
#1: The London Eye - Created for the millennium celebration, one of the world's largest ferris wheels is a site to behold.

London Eye Vacation Travel Guide | Expedia
http://www.expedia.com/London-Eye-London.d6047451.Vacation-Attraction
For a unique view of London, UK, enjoy some sightseeing on the London Eye.
This giant F...
http://www.expedia.com/London-Eye-London.d6047451.Vacation-Attraction
For a unique view of London, UK, enjoy some sightseeing on the London Eye.
This giant Ferris wheel is over 400 feet tall, and it is one of the largest structures in the city. Some 3.5 million people ride it annually, making it one of the United Kingdom’s most popular tourist attractions. The Eye operates late into the evening, making it a perfect way to cap off a busy day of sightseeing. Believe us, if you thought London was lovely in the daylight, wait till you see it from the London Eye during the night—the city, lit up, is a glittering sight you’ll never forget.
Climb into one of the 32 air conditioned gondolas, sit down (or stand up!), and enjoy a London Eye tour. Every half-hour, the wheel completes a rotation, meaning you get a full 30 minutes to see the capital city from a height and angle previously only reachable by birds. On a clear day, you can see up to 25 miles in all directions. Now that’s a breathtaking view.
